Hi All.
I have just purchased a 2012 1.6 200 , having previously had a 2.0 HDI which unfortunately was written off. My question is with the new car the SatNav is telling me that I am in Northern France, when I start the car there is a notice saying Sim card not present or fitted incorrectly, would this be the SIM card holderthat is inside the arm rest console. There was no SIM card present when I purchased the car only noticed whilst driving the car back home.
The screen also states that there are no Satellites visible is this because the Card is not in place.

Should there be a card in place for the Sat Nav to function properly, the person I bought the car from has sent me an Maps SD card which makes no difference which fits in the slot in the NG4 3D.
The frustrating thing is if I put in my home address in Plymouth and then start driving it will then start to give me directions and with a map as i said in Northern France.!!!!!

Any help/guidance would be appreciated.👍👍

Final version of NG4 software is: "ng4_D_N42c_N42.03"

This is the last firmware (N42c) and updating the maps should be working without re-flashing the SatNav.

I successfully updated two cars (mine not included) - one Citroen and one Peugeot with my tutorial without issues.

I do not know how to help you since I do not know where it stops working. Most often issues are: 1) using Quick Format for USB and SD - you should use regular format (longer); 2) Not deleting hidden files from USB and SD - make sure to delete them.

Hi. I only downloaded the maps zip file and fat 32 formatted a 32gig USB stick and a 32gig SD card. I checked the hidden files and there were non showing. So I unzipped the maps into both drives. Tried the SD card first in the car and the head unit did not recognise it there was no automatic download just nothing. So I then tried the USB stick in the armrest socket and again nothing.

When I unzipped the Maps files it was showing two folders one Cartes and another one is that all there should be?

Contents of the "Cartes" map (not the map itself) should be copied to the USB. After you copy to the USB, then check for the hidden files on the USB.

This is how your USB should look like. You can also follow this video (although its in French) -
